Why Do I Need an Estate Plan?

“Why didn’t Grandma plan for this?” I muttered, sifting through stacks of paperwork. The weight of responsibility felt crushing. Estate planning isn’t just for the wealthy or elderly; it’s a fundamental aspect of financial security for everyone.

A well-structured estate plan minimizes taxes, ensures your assets are distributed according to your wishes, and protects your loved ones from unnecessary burdens. Consider this: over 50% of Americans die without a will, leaving their families to grapple with complex legal proceedings and potential disputes.

Furthermore, estate planning encompasses more than just wills. It can include trusts, powers of attorney, healthcare directives—essential tools for navigating life’s uncertainties.

What Happens if I Don’t Have an Estate Plan?

“Grandma’s passing opened a Pandora’s Box,” confided my cousin Emily, her voice laced with frustration. Without a will, our family was embroiled in a lengthy probate process, contentious arguments erupted over asset distribution, and significant legal fees depleted Grandma’s estate.

Emily’s experience served as a stark reminder of the potential consequences of neglecting estate planning. Without clear instructions, the state dictates how your assets are divided, which may not align with your wishes, potentially leading to unintended outcomes and family discord.
